The EasyExDrive is a robust drivebase concept designed for the FIRST Robotics Competition, constructed from 30mm and 20mm extrusion that accommodates any 6'' wheel with a 1/2'' hex bore. It boasts a bumper mounting rail/handle, ensuring effortless machinability and modularity. Had the 2020 season not been abruptly cancelled, FRC Team 6929 Cuivre & Or would have utilized this innovative drivebase concept during Infinite Recharge. Engineered to be highly durable, it utilizes 3/16" aluminum plate (polycarb alternatives can also be employed in specific situations) and M5, M6, M8, and 10-32 fasteners. This marks the initial phase of a comprehensive base design, with further iterations and refinements yet to come. V2 revisions streamlined the manufacturing process, prioritizing ease of prototyping for Team #6929 Cuivre & Or.
